- Macon, United States
- http://101.126.157.85:3001/triple-glazing-installers-near-me9708
-
Discover the factors influencing triple glazing cost & make an informed decision. Learn about benefits, materials & installation costs here.
- Joined on
2025-10-30
Block a user
No matching results found.